陸冬妹,鄧小芳
(1. 百色學(xué)院 物理與電信工程系,百色 533000;2. 桂林電子科技大學(xué) 信息與通信學(xué)院,桂林 541004)
UWB(超寬帶)技術(shù)作為一種全新技術(shù),因其自身的特點(diǎn)和優(yōu)勢,從其誕生之日起就一直受到人們的關(guān)注[2]。近年來,隨著對其研究的深入和相關(guān)技術(shù)的發(fā)展,UWB技術(shù)的應(yīng)用范圍越來越廣,已經(jīng)從最初的局限于雷達(dá)方面逐漸發(fā)展到無線通信、目標(biāo)定位、探測等諸多方面,成為當(dāng)前研究的熱點(diǎn)。
本文根據(jù)UWB信號的定義,將M腳本文件與Simulink仿真相結(jié)合,建立了UWB信號仿真模型。
UWB通信系統(tǒng)采用超短脈沖(脈沖持續(xù)時間小于1 ns)作為信息載體,通過有用信息控制超短脈沖相對于定時時刻的位置,即脈沖位置調(diào)制(PPM),實(shí)現(xiàn)信號調(diào)制[3]。在多用戶通信情況下,采用跳時擴(kuò)頻多址技術(shù),用偽隨機(jī)跳時碼將超短脈沖的出現(xiàn)時刻隨機(jī)化。一個跳時碼周期內(nèi)的UWB信號表達(dá)式為(1):
其中,αi表示調(diào)制碼元序列,以等概率取值+1和-1;P(t)為窄脈沖波形;Ts為信息碼元持續(xù)時間,由Ns幀組成,每1幀里包含1個脈沖;Tf為幀的持續(xù)時間;δ為信息碼元調(diào)制參數(shù),表示脈沖位置調(diào)制(PPM)時,單位碼元引起的脈沖時移;bi指第i個信息碼元,biδ表示由信息調(diào)制引起的時移; ciTc表示由跳時碼引起的時移,ci為跳時碼序列, ci是整數(shù),取值范圍是[0,Nk-1];ci為每一個跳時碼的持續(xù)時問,ciTc表示由跳時碼引起的時移,NkTc<Tf。在每一幀中,脈沖在時間軸上的位置由信息碼元調(diào)制參數(shù)δ和跳時碼ci共同決定,設(shè)TTH=Nb×Ts, Nk為正整數(shù)[4]。
本文設(shè)計(jì)一個具有加性高斯噪聲的超寬帶發(fā)射和接收系統(tǒng):發(fā)射機(jī)是直接擴(kuò)頻序列脈沖幅度調(diào)制發(fā)射機(jī);信道是帶有加性高斯噪聲的多徑通道;接收機(jī)采用RAKE接收機(jī)。根據(jù)UWB信號的定義,信息調(diào)制方式選擇脈沖幅度調(diào)制(PAM).在一個跳時碼周期 內(nèi),建立3大部分,分別實(shí)現(xiàn)超寬帶信號的產(chǎn)生信號的傳輸、信號的接收。系統(tǒng)模型如圖1所示。
圖1 UWB系統(tǒng)模型
在發(fā)射端,數(shù)據(jù)直接對射頻脈沖調(diào)制,再通過可編程延時器件對脈沖進(jìn)一步時延控制,最后通過超寬帶天線發(fā)射出去。在接收端,信號通過相關(guān)器與本地模板波形相乘,積分后通過抽樣保持電路送到基帶信號處理電路中,由捕獲跟蹤部分、時鐘振蕩器和(跳時)碼產(chǎn)生器控制可編程延時器,根據(jù)相應(yīng)的時延產(chǎn)生本地模板波形,與接收信號相乘。整個收發(fā)信機(jī)幾乎全部由數(shù)字電路構(gòu)成,便于降低成本和小型化。
由于UWB信號需要用時域的方法進(jìn)行分析,多用于戶內(nèi)密集多徑(多徑可達(dá)到30條)的條件下,而且每條路徑的信號能量都很小,難以對每條信道做出估計(jì),所以使UWB信號的Rake接收成為可能。Rake接收機(jī)使原來能量很小的多徑信號經(jīng)過能量合并后提高的信噪比提高系統(tǒng)性能[5]。
圖2 UWB信道模塊
脈沖形成器的頻譜性能直接決定整個發(fā)射機(jī)輸出的頻譜性能。 脈沖形成器將前級放大器輸出的射頻信號經(jīng)過功分器一分為二路成為各自獨(dú)立的、幅度可調(diào)的信號,并在其中一路引入移相器,利用矢量合成原理,通過合成器將兩路信號再合成起來,以達(dá)到同時控制射頻脈沖形狀和相位的功能。通過脈沖形成器對射頻脈沖信號進(jìn)行整形可改善發(fā)射頻譜旁瓣,并對激勵脈沖前后沿期間速調(diào)管放大器非線性特性引起的相位失真進(jìn)行補(bǔ)償,從而使發(fā)射頻譜滿足指標(biāo)要求。
脈沖形成器中同相3分貝電橋?qū)⑤斎胄盘栆环譃槎?,各包含一只PIN調(diào)制衰減器,獨(dú)立地調(diào)整所通過信號的幅度和形狀。 脈沖形成器輸出部分的同相3分貝電橋?qū)⒔?jīng)過調(diào)制、衰減、移相的射頻信號再合成起來,而兩路信號的矢量和決定合成信號的幅度和相位。
為了補(bǔ)償PIN調(diào)制衰減器的溫度特性,我們特意加了控溫電路。由埋置在PIN調(diào)制衰減器基板附近的溫度傳感器錄取信號,經(jīng)控溫電路來控制加熱元件,使PIN調(diào)制衰減器的基板溫度維持在55℃±5℃。
超寬帶通信具有傳輸速率高、抗多徑干擾能力強(qiáng)、對現(xiàn)有通信系統(tǒng)干擾小等眾多優(yōu)點(diǎn),研究超寬帶通信的室內(nèi)信道特性及其隨機(jī)統(tǒng)計(jì)模型具有重要的現(xiàn)實(shí)意義,它直接決定了系統(tǒng)調(diào)制方式的選擇、最大通信速率和最大通信距離等關(guān)鍵指標(biāo),指導(dǎo)著超寬帶接收機(jī)的設(shè)計(jì)。UWB信道模塊圖如圖2所示。
圖3 UWB信號使能和檢測模塊
發(fā)射的二進(jìn)制源碼為11110001,經(jīng)過脈沖幅度調(diào)制,發(fā)射出攜帶信息的高斯脈沖波型。發(fā)射波形的輸出受多個參數(shù)影響,主要是伯努利信號源產(chǎn)生的碼元種子,直接擴(kuò)頻序列,數(shù)據(jù)調(diào)制方式和高斯波形的放大倍數(shù)與波形持續(xù)時間。輸出波形隨碼元變換后表現(xiàn)出不同的形式,同時調(diào)制方式的影響也至關(guān)重要。系統(tǒng)可以采用BPSK和OOK兩種調(diào)制方式,雖然OOK調(diào)制相對簡單,但其抗干擾能力差、解調(diào)復(fù)雜,所以系統(tǒng)仿真以BPSK方式調(diào)制信號為主。系統(tǒng)分別采用不同調(diào)制和不同二進(jìn)制碼元,該系統(tǒng)發(fā)射機(jī)仿真圖如圖4所示。
圖4 BPSK方式的發(fā)射波形
發(fā)射的調(diào)制信號,經(jīng)過信道損耗和噪聲的引入,會發(fā)生比較大的變化。影響此波形的主要因素是信噪比的設(shè)置,如果信噪比(SNR)設(shè)置過低不但信號的輸出波形幅度較低,而且碼元傳輸出錯率也會較高。再將帶有噪聲和損耗的信號經(jīng)過RAKE接收機(jī)抽樣使能,輸出與發(fā)射碼元同步的信號。接收機(jī)的接收時鐘必須與信息碼元時鐘同步。系統(tǒng)可以采用EG、MR、MMSE和WSMR四種分集合并方式,本系統(tǒng)采用EG方式。信號仿真輸出信號圖如圖5所示。
圖5 帶有噪聲的信道輸出和RAKE接收機(jī)的接收信號
觀察圖5可見:UWB信道輸出帶有噪聲和損耗的信號,經(jīng)過RAKE接收機(jī)抽樣使能,輸出與發(fā)射碼元同步的有效信號,仿真證明該系統(tǒng)模型構(gòu)建成功。
同步發(fā)射與接收到的信號進(jìn)行比較,從而對RAKE接收機(jī)性能進(jìn)行評估。接收機(jī)性能評估,如圖6所示。圖6中顯示了發(fā)射和接收對比輸出的結(jié)果。顯示窗口有三個文本框,第一個表示數(shù)據(jù)接收的出錯率,第二個文本框表示發(fā)射與接收對比出錯的個數(shù),第三個文本框表示接收的信息碼元數(shù)。系統(tǒng)的出錯監(jiān)測參數(shù)主要從右邊的出錯評估器進(jìn)行設(shè)置,它包括五個設(shè)置項(xiàng),信息碼元延時,仿真檢錯延時數(shù)值,仿真應(yīng)用模式,數(shù)據(jù)輸出形式和仿真停止參數(shù)。其中,前兩個設(shè)置至關(guān)重要,如果設(shè)置不當(dāng),即使系統(tǒng)能接收正確仿真結(jié)果仍是錯誤的。信息碼元延時,主要用來協(xié)調(diào)發(fā)射數(shù)據(jù)與接收數(shù)據(jù)的同步,它與接收機(jī)的通道時延,碼片時間,碼元信息傳輸速率和抽樣時間都有關(guān)系,本系統(tǒng)的碼元接收延遲時間設(shè)置為:2+ceil(max(Channel.SigPath)*xtcs.Ts/xtcs.Tb) (1)
因系統(tǒng)剛運(yùn)行不能馬上處于穩(wěn)定狀態(tài),數(shù)據(jù)的傳輸就容易出錯,所以軟件設(shè)計(jì)中應(yīng)考慮將開始傳輸?shù)膸讉€碼元舍去,本系統(tǒng)通過設(shè)置檢錯延時數(shù)值來減少仿真出錯率,最大程度上保證仿真的正確性??紤]到本系統(tǒng)的信息碼元傳輸時間為:5e-9,所以延時數(shù)值應(yīng)保證大于5納秒。仿真應(yīng)用模式用來設(shè)置延時的應(yīng)用范圍,本系統(tǒng)將其設(shè)置為有效域?yàn)檎麄€仿真系統(tǒng)。數(shù)據(jù)模式主要用來限定輸出參數(shù)的有效性,本系統(tǒng)設(shè)置為端口有效,而不是整個工作空間。仿真停止參數(shù)選項(xiàng)默認(rèn)為自動,系統(tǒng)對其進(jìn)行設(shè)置,當(dāng)它滿足錯誤碼元數(shù)為100或最大接收個數(shù)為4983時仿真停止。
圖6 UWB系統(tǒng)發(fā)射與接收信號的對比
利用軟件仿真技術(shù)來輔助理論研究,以驗(yàn)證研究結(jié)果,是現(xiàn)代科研工作者使用的主要研究方法之一。本文借助MATLAB軟件提供的強(qiáng)大計(jì)算及仿真功能,為UWB信號的研究建立了仿真模型。本文以MATLAB環(huán)境為開發(fā)平臺設(shè)計(jì)一個具有加性高斯噪聲的超寬帶發(fā)射和接收系統(tǒng),經(jīng)仿真測試帶有噪聲和損耗的信號經(jīng)過RAKE接收機(jī)抽樣使能,能輸出與發(fā)射碼元同步的信號,系統(tǒng)模型構(gòu)建仿真成功。
[1] 蘇金鵬,王永利.MATLAB7.0實(shí)用指南[M].北京:電子工業(yè)出版社,2004.
[2] 葛利嘉,等.超寬帶無線電基礎(chǔ)[M].北京:電子工業(yè)出版社,2005.
[3] 樊孝明.超寬帶無線通信極窄脈沖產(chǎn)生的設(shè)計(jì)與研究[J].桂林電子工業(yè)學(xué)院,2005.
[4] 李振強(qiáng),王鋒, 張水蓮.超寬帶通信系統(tǒng)的Simulink仿真實(shí)現(xiàn)[J].計(jì)算機(jī)仿真,2005,22(5):153-155.
[5] 羅振東,高宏,劉元安,等.抑制多窄帶干擾的超寬帶脈沖設(shè)計(jì)方法[J].北京郵電大學(xué)學(xué)報(bào),2005,28(1):55-58.